About This Position

Description:

The Animal Welfare Associate is an integral component of Santa Fe Animal Shelter's lifesaving mission to create a compassionate, safe community for pets and people. By approaching every case with a solution not excuses mindset, the Animal Welfare Associate provides pet owners a judgement free experience as their needs are assessed, support options are explored and supported, when possible, to provide resources needed to keep pets in the home.

Essential Functions and Responsibilities:

  • Greet customers
  • Operate a multi-line phone system
  • Animal Handling as per SFAS approved and adopted Fear Free Methods
  • Financial transaction processing
  • Data Entry
  • Appointment scheduling
  • Handling of deceased animals for cremation
  • Conduct themself in alignment with SFAS Guiding Principles, Rules of Engagement and policies
  • Represent SFAS in a professional, caring, and solution-oriented manner while embracing a"Solutions, Not Excuses" motto
  • Attend regular team huddles, meetings and training sessions providing feedback regarding processes, procedures, programs, operations.
  • Participate in maintaining the work environment clean and free of clutter (throwing trash, sweeping, mopping, washing down counters)
  • Dog walking, medication distribution and distribution enrichment items
  • Provide Animal Care Support with kennel cleaning, dishes and laundry as needed
  • Actively contribute to department and organization goals by meeting targets for: Return to owner animals, donations, store & ID tag sales
  • Stay up to date with changes to internal protocol and procedure
  • Be open and flexible to new concepts and pilot programs
  • Participate in professional development opportunities
  • Practice self-care and boundary-setting.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Within six (6) months from date of hire, the Animal Welfare Associate must demonstrate strong practical knowledge, skills and proficiency in the following:

  • Independent decision making utilizing critical thinking skills and provided tools to ensure the best possible outcome for pets and their people.
  • Intake Diversion through case management that supports community members with challenges to successful pet ownership through both SFAS and community resources and programs.
  • Navigation of commonly used software and social media platforms.
  • Reducing length of stay in line with SFAS protocols and best practices.
